At the core of any gym or home gym is the weight bench. For sure, there are literally hundreds of benches of all quality, shape and construction available for purchase on the market. Be careful when looking at these kinds of benches because many of them may not be nearly as purpose-built or sturdy as advertised in magazines or on TV or in a store, by the way.
What should be looked for when it comes to this kind of bench is the quality of its build, its adjustability, how ergonomically functional it is, how durable it is and what its price is. Keep those qualities in mind when shopping for any bench whether on the Internet or at a fitness store or the like. More people have been disappointed by their benches than with any other piece of equipment.
This is why it is never a good idea to go for the most inexpensive weight bench one can find, generally speaking. Consider that one will be laying on it and possibly lifting a lot of weight one day. Risking injury from a weight bench that may collapse isn’t very smart. This is why it may make more sense to spend a bit more on a high-quality and very durable bench.
For the most part, the best in sturdiest benches are usually built with a steel frame that is capable of supporting a lot of weight, including the weight of the person lifting and all of the weight that is being lifted. Some of the best can help support over 600 pounds and really don’t cost all that more money than the cheaper models. The sturdiness and build quality counts for a lot with a bench.
For those people who are just getting started in weightlifting, it is better to go for a basic bench that can be raised and lowered rather than some sort of specialty bench that promises a lot of other positions but really isn’t needed at this time. With a bench that raises and lowers, a wider range of weightlifting positions can be taken. Along with barbells, it’s usually about all that’s needed.
Most weightlifters and weightlifting experts recommend purchasing a bench that has an adjustable incline capability. This is pretty much a mandatory requirement if you intend on doing any serious lifting. Being able to raise and lower the back allows for a much wider range of weight training exercises and would be available with a bench that is just flat and cannot be adjusted.
Those who may want to jump more fully into weight training might consider purchasing a bench that has the capability for performing leg curls or leg extensions. Some benches come with a permanently attached piece that allows this while others come with the piece as a separate attachment.
